pg电子维护,保障数据库健康运行的关键pg电子维护
本文目录导读:
随着信息技术的快速发展,数据库作为企业核心业务的基础设施,扮演着越来越重要的角色,pg电子维护作为数据库管理的重要组成部分,直接关系到企业的数据安全、系统性能和业务连续性,本文将从pg电子维护的定义、重要性、具体步骤、常见问题及解决方案等方面,深入探讨如何通过专业的pg电子维护,确保数据库的健康稳定运行。
什么是pg电子维护
pg电子维护是指通过对数据库的硬件、软件、网络、用户和数据等方面进行全面的检查、分析和优化,以确保数据库在运行过程中达到最佳状态,pg电子维护的核心目标是保障数据库的可用性、可靠性和安全性,同时提升系统的整体性能和效率。
在实际应用中,pg电子维护的范围通常包括以下几个方面:
- 硬件维护:包括服务器的清洁、电源管理、硬件设备的检查等。
- 软件维护:包括操作系统、数据库管理软件(如PostgreSQL)的更新、应用软件的优化等。
- 网络维护:包括网络设备的检查、网络拓扑的优化、网络流量的监控等。
- 用户管理维护:包括用户权限的管理、用户权限的分配、用户活跃度的分析等。
- 数据维护:包括数据备份、数据恢复、数据冗余的管理等。
pg电子维护的重要性
-
保障数据安全
数据是企业的核心资产,pg电子维护通过定期检查和优化,可以有效防止数据泄露、数据损坏、系统漏洞等问题,确保数据的安全性。 -
提升系统性能
通过pg电子维护,可以及时发现和解决系统性能问题,优化资源利用率,提升系统的整体运行效率。 -
延长系统 lifespan
正常的pg电子维护可以延缓数据库的物理和逻辑 degradation,延长数据库设备的使用寿命,降低硬件更换的成本。 -
确保业务连续性
在发生故障时,pg电子维护能够快速响应,及时恢复数据库服务,避免业务中断,保障企业的运营。
pg电子维护的步骤
-
制定维护计划
根据企业的实际情况,制定详细的pg电子维护计划,包括维护的目标、范围、时间安排、维护人员等。 -
硬件检查与清洁
- 检查服务器的物理状态,包括电源、内存、存储设备等。
- 清洁服务器的外部环境,包括灰尘、异物等,避免影响硬件的正常运行。
- 检查和更换硬件设备,如硬盘、网卡、电源模块等。
-
软件优化与更新
- 更新数据库管理软件(如PostgreSQL)到最新版本,修复已知的漏洞,优化性能。
- 更新操作系统和应用软件,确保其与数据库版本兼容。
- 优化应用程序的代码,减少对数据库的负载。
-
网络优化
- 检查和配置网络设备,包括路由器、交换机等,确保网络的稳定性和安全性。
- 优化网络拓扑结构,减少网络延迟和拥塞。
- 配置防火墙和入侵检测系统(IDS),保障网络的安全性。
-
用户管理优化
- 定期分析用户活跃度,关闭不再活跃的用户账号,释放资源。
- 合理分配用户权限,避免权限滥用。
- 配置用户认证和授权机制,提升系统的安全性。
-
数据备份与恢复
- 定期进行数据备份,使用灾难恢复解决方案(DRS)确保数据的安全性和可用性。
- 配置数据恢复点(RPO)和灾难恢复点(DRPO),制定数据恢复计划。
- 定期检查备份数据的完整性、可用性和一致性。
-
性能监控与调优
- 配置性能监控工具(如PostgreSQL的pg monitor),实时监控数据库的运行状态。
- 分析数据库的查询日志,优化查询性能。
- 调整数据库的参数设置,如增加内存大小、优化查询计划等。
-
安全检查与漏洞修复
- 定期进行安全审计,识别和修复潜在的安全漏洞。
- 配置防火墙、入侵检测系统和安全代理,保障数据库的安全性。
- 修复已知的漏洞,避免因软件缺陷导致的安全风险。
-
文档管理与知识共享
- 制定pg电子维护的文档,包括维护计划、维护步骤、维护工具的使用说明等。
- 鼓励团队成员分享维护经验和知识,提升整体的维护水平。
常见问题及解决方案
-
数据库崩溃或性能瓶颈
- 问题:数据库频繁崩溃或运行缓慢,影响业务。
- 解决方案:
- 定期进行pg电子维护,优化查询性能。
- 配置足够的内存和磁盘空间,避免因资源不足导致的性能瓶颈。
- 使用性能监控工具,及时发现和解决性能问题。
-
数据不一致或丢失
- 问题:由于维护不当或系统故障,导致数据不一致或丢失。
- 解决方案:
- 配置数据备份和灾难恢复解决方案。
- 定期进行数据恢复测试,确保数据恢复的准确性。
- 避免频繁的数据库备份,以免增加存储负担。
-
网络连接不稳定
- 问题:网络连接不稳定,影响数据库的访问和维护。
- 解决方案:
- 检查网络设备的配置,确保网络连接正常。
- 配置静态IP地址,避免因动态IP地址导致的网络问题。
- 使用VPN等安全措施,保障网络的稳定性。
-
用户权限管理混乱
- 问题:用户权限管理不规范,导致权限滥用或资源浪费。
- 解决方案:
- 合理分配用户权限,确保每个用户都有明确的职责。
- 使用权限管理工具,自动分配和管理用户权限。
- 定期审查用户活跃度,关闭不再活跃的用户账号。
pg电子维护的最佳实践
-
制定详细的维护计划
- 明确维护的目标、范围、时间安排和维护人员。
- 制定应急预案,应对可能出现的突发问题。
-
优先处理高优先级问题
- 根据问题的紧急性和影响范围,优先处理高优先级的问题。
- 确保关键业务不受影响,避免因小问题导致的业务中断。
-
使用工具自动化维护
- 配置自动化脚本,定期执行维护任务。
- 使用CI/CD工具,自动化数据库的部署和测试。
-
加强团队培训
- 定期组织pg电子维护培训,提升团队成员的技能和知识。
- 鼓励团队成员分享经验,提升整体的维护水平。
-
注重文档管理
- 制定详细的维护文档,包括维护步骤、工具配置、测试结果等。
- 使用文档管理系统,方便团队成员查阅和协作。
pg电子维护工具推荐
-
PostgreSQL
- 功能:
- 提供强大的查询优化工具(如pg monitor)。
- 支持自动备份和恢复(Aurora)。
- 提供性能分析工具(如pg_stat)。
- 优势:
- 开源、免费、高度可定制。
- 性能优化能力强,适合大规模数据库。
- 功能:
-
Veeam Backup & Replication
- 功能:
- 提供数据备份和灾难恢复解决方案。
- 支持全量备份、增量备份和恢复。
- 提供数据恢复点和灾难恢复点配置。
- 优势:
- 高可用性、高可靠性。
- 支持多云环境,方便数据迁移和恢复。
- 功能:
-
Jenkins
- 功能:
- 提供自动化CI/CD工具。
- 支持构建和部署PostgreSQL数据库。
- 提供持续集成和持续交付的解决方案。
- 优势:
- 提高维护效率,减少人工操作。
- 支持自动化测试和部署。
- 功能:
-
Nmap
- 功能:
- 提供网络扫描和渗透测试工具。
- 支持扫描网络设备,查找潜在的安全漏洞。
- 提供端口扫描和子网扫描功能。
- 优势:
- 快速发现网络中的潜在问题。
- 适合进行安全审计和漏洞修复。
- 功能:
-
PostgreSQL Undo Log Manager (PLUM)
- 功能:
- 提供数据恢复和undo log管理功能。
- 支持快速恢复数据库。
- 提供undo log的监控和管理。
- 优势:
- 提高数据恢复的效率和准确性。
- 支持多版本管理,避免数据丢失。
- 功能:
pg电子维护是保障数据库健康运行的关键环节,通过定期的硬件检查、软件优化、网络维护、用户管理、数据备份和性能监控等步骤,可以有效提升数据库的性能、安全性和稳定性,合理使用pg电子维护工具和制定最佳实践,可以进一步提高维护效率和效果。
在实际应用中,pg电子维护需要团队成员的共同努力,包括定期的维护计划、专业的工具使用、系统的持续优化以及团队的不断学习和提升,只有通过全面的pg电子维护,才能确保数据库在复杂的业务环境中稳定运行,为企业创造更大的价值。
pg电子维护,保障数据库健康运行的关键pg电子维护,
发表评论